From 82a589576a934e0d40f532cbf170a705142fb73a Mon Sep 17 00:00:00 2001 From: Robin Krahl Date: Sat, 26 Jan 2019 12:42:04 +0100 Subject: common: Deactive installation of recommended dependencies --- common/files/apt-80recommends | 1 + common/tasks/apt.yaml | 7 +++++++ common/tasks/main.yaml | 1 + 3 files changed, 9 insertions(+) create mode 100644 common/files/apt-80recommends create mode 100644 common/tasks/apt.yaml diff --git a/common/files/apt-80recommends b/common/files/apt-80recommends new file mode 100644 index 0000000..96d6728 --- /dev/null +++ b/common/files/apt-80recommends @@ -0,0 +1 @@ +APT::Install-Recommends "false"; diff --git a/common/tasks/apt.yaml b/common/tasks/apt.yaml new file mode 100644 index 0000000..9b3bdae --- /dev/null +++ b/common/tasks/apt.yaml @@ -0,0 +1,7 @@ +- name: Copy apt configuration + copy: + src: apt-80recommends + dest: /etc/apt/apt.conf.d/80recommends + owner: root + group: root + mode: u=rw,g=r,o=r diff --git a/common/tasks/main.yaml b/common/tasks/main.yaml index 819cbe6..7c56e23 100644 --- a/common/tasks/main.yaml +++ b/common/tasks/main.yaml @@ -1,5 +1,6 @@ --- - include: packages.yaml +- include: apt.yaml - include: sh.yaml - include: ssh.yaml - include: sudo.yaml -- cgit v1.2.3